University of Maryland Global Campus (UMGC) seeks a Vice President of Procurement (VP) to lead the global procurement function including a team and policies and procedures. Reporting directly to the Senior Vice President and Chief Operating Officer, this VP is responsible for procuring goods, services, and technologies that enable enterprise strategy, vision, and mission. The VP will provide leadership in establishing and maintaining procurement governance - a framework that defines clear policies, processes, and decision-making authority to promote ethical, transparent, and strategy-aligned activities. They will also develop effective sourcing strategies, optimize the stewardship of organizational / state funds, and strengthen supplier relationships while mitigating risks. This VP champions the innovation of procurement practices, identifies opportunities for process improvements, and builds a high-performing, collaborative team that advances organizational excellence while fostering compliance and accountability.

Additional responsibilities include :
Strategic Leadership
- Develops and executes procurement strategies aligned with the organization's overall strategic goals and objectives
- Establishes and directs departmental goals that support broader organizational objectives, fostering alignment across functional teams
- Oversees the implementation of policies, procedures, and systems to standardize procurement practices and optimize efficiency
- Partners with enterprise-wide Business Units to develop performance metrics
- Collaborates with senior leadership to align procurement priorities with organizational goals
- Represents the procurement function in executive meetings, providing insight and expertise on procurement strategies and risks
- Leads initiatives to improve procurement processes and adopt new technologies, fostering innovation across the department

Required education and experience : A demonstrated ability to get things done. An earned Master's degree from an accredited institution of higher learning; a total of at least 10 years of success leading enterprise procurement teams in government or corporate environments with substantial procurement portfolios; expertise utilizing data and metrics to inform decisions, practices, and improvements; and a track record of being an inspiring, high-energy, team-player / coach able to quickly gain credibility and build relationships across and outside of the organization.
Preferred experience : Certification by a national professional purchasing organization; state of Maryland MBE experience; experience in a higher education workplace; e xecutive presence with the ability to communicate well with both technically expert and non-technical audiences; as well as a particular ease, finesse, and discernment that results from organizational and emotional intelligence.
